How is a participle formed?
liraira [26]

Each verb in English has two participles, they are present participle and a past participle. You use the present participle in the present progressive tenses, which indicate that an action is ongoing or continuous. For regular verbs, the present participle uses the ing form of a verb

The past participle helps form the present perfect tense because this tense spans both the past and present. Regular past participles are formed by adding ed to the verb.
